Definition

1) Suppress (verb): to restrain or prevent the development, action, or expression of (something).
2) Suppress (verb): to forcibly put an end to something.
3) Suppress (verb): to keep something secret or hidden.

Examples

Suppress Example in a sentence

1) The police had to suppress the riot before it escalated further.

2) She tried to suppress a yawn during the boring meeting.

3) The dictator used violence to suppress any opposition to his rule.

4) He had to suppress his anger when his boss criticized his work.

5) The medication helped suppress her allergy symptoms.

6) The company tried to suppress negative reviews about their product.

7) It is not healthy to suppress your emotions all the time.

8) The government attempted to suppress the spread of fake news.

9) She had to suppress a laugh when her friend tripped and fell.

10) The firefighters worked to suppress the wildfire before it reached any homes.
